想玩汉诺塔吗,但总卡在某一关,别着急,其实这游戏有窍门,掌握几个核心技巧,你就能轻松通关,甚至挑战更高难度,今天这篇攻略,就带你从零开始,一步步成为汉诺塔高手。

1、理解规则是第一步汉诺塔的规则很简单,有三根柱子,若干圆盘,圆盘大小不同,大的在下面,小的在上面,目标是把所有圆盘,从一根柱子,移到另一根,移动时有个限制,一次只能动一个盘,而且大盘不能压小盘,听起来容易吧,但盘一多就复杂了,所以先别急着移,花点时间,彻底搞懂规则,这是所有技巧的基础。
2、找到最小移动步数你知道吗,汉诺塔有最优解,移动n个盘,最少需要2的n次方减1步,比如3个盘,最少要7步,4个盘要15步,这个公式很重要,它能帮你判断,你的解法是否高效,如果你移的步数,远远超过这个数,说明方法可能错了,需要调整思路,朝着最少步数努力,是通关的关键。
3、学会递归思维这是汉诺塔的核心,听起来有点抽象,其实很简单,就是把大问题,分解成小问题,比如要移5个盘,你可以先想,怎么移上面4个,然后再移最下面那个,接着再处理那4个,这样一层层分解,问题就变简单了,多练习几次,你就能形成条件反射,看到盘子数量,脑子里自动就有步骤。
4、从少到多循序渐进千万别一开始,就挑战8个盘、10个盘,那样很容易受挫,建议从3个盘开始练,把步骤练到滚瓜烂熟,然后再尝试4个盘,接着是5个盘,这样循序渐进,你的思维会越来越清晰,每增加一个盘,只是多重复几次,前面学会的步骤,基础打牢了,后面自然水到渠成。
记住这些要点后,我们来实战一下,假设你现在有3个盘,目标是从A柱移到C柱,按照递归思维,第一步,先把上面两个盘,借助C柱移到B柱,第二步,把最大的盘,从A直接移到C,第三步,再把B柱上的两个盘,借助A柱移到C,看,是不是很简单。
当你熟练后,可以尝试更多盘,或者给自己设限,比如只用最少步数完成,或者挑战时间,汉诺塔不仅是游戏,更能锻炼逻辑思维,和解决问题的能力,很多编程思想,也源于此,所以多玩有益。

玩汉诺塔别怕难,理解规则,记住公式,运用递归,循序渐进,按照这个攻略来,你一定能轻松通关,享受解开谜题的乐趣,现在就去试试吧。

造梦西游之黎尤浩劫篇灵宠大全
未定事件簿新春活动有哪些
造梦西游之黎尤浩劫篇怎么玩
斗破苍穹手游摘星老鬼怎么样
永劫无间方诺攻略
斗破苍穹手游紫妍怎么样
方舟生存进化棘背龙吃什么驯服
吉星派对局内任务怎么完成
未定事件簿故城长燃的薪火怎么玩
绝区零2.6版本内容介绍
潮汐守望者武圣关羽怎么样
全民祖玛公测时间什么时候
火影忍者新春主题活动有哪些
第五人格春节主题1V4限时玩法介绍
百战群英手游征战四方怎么玩
星绘友晴天编辑器怎么用
造梦西游之黎尤浩劫篇兑换码介绍
战神域公测时间是什么时候